>>> The full-text of the draft resolution proposed by the Apache Beam PPMC:
>>> 
>>>    X. Establish the Apache Beam Project
>>> 
>>>       WHEREAS, the Board of Directors deems it to be in the best
>>>       interests of the Foundation and consistent with the
>>>       Foundation's purpose to establish a Project Management
>>>       Committee charged with the creation and maintenance of
>>>       open-source software, for distribution at no charge to
>>>       the public, related to a unified programming model for both
>>>       batch and streaming data processing, enabling efficient
>>>       execution across diverse distributed execution engines
>>>       and providing extensibility points for connecting to different
>>>       technologies and user communities.
>>> 
>>>       N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ED, that a Project Management
>>>       Committee (PMC), to be known as the "Apache Beam Project",
>>>       be and hereby is established pursuant to Bylaws of the
>>>       Foundation; and be it further
>>> 
>>>       RESOLVED, that the Apache Beam Project be and hereby is
>>>       responsible for the creation and maintenance of software
>>>       related to a unified programming model for both batch and
>>>       streaming data processing, enabling efficient execution across
>>>       diverse distributed execution engines and providing extensibility
>>>       points for connecting to different technologies and user
>>>       communities; and be it further
>>> 
>>>       RESOLVED, that the office of "Vice President, Apache Beam" be
>>>       and hereby is created, the person holding such office to
>>>       serve at the direction of the Board of Directors as the chair
>>>       of the Apache Beam Project, and to have primary responsibility
>>>       for management of the projects within the scope of
>>>       responsibility of the Apache Beam Project; and be it further
>>> 
>>>       RESOLVED, that the persons listed immediately below be and
>>>       hereby are appointed to serve as the initial members of the
>>>       Apache Beam Project:
>>> 
>>>         * Tyler Akidau <taki...@apache.org>
>>>         * Davor Bonaci <da...@apache.org>
>>>         * Robert Bradshaw <rober...@apache.org>
>>>         * Ben Chambers <bchamb...@apache.org>
>>>         * Luke Cwik <lc...@apache.org>
>>>         * Stephan Ewen <se...@apache.org>
>>>         * Dan Halperin <dhalp...@apache.org>
>>>         * Kenneth Knowles <k...@apache.org>
>>>         * Aljoscha Krettek <aljos...@apache.org>
>>>         * Maximilian Michels <m...@apache.org>
>>>         * Jean-Baptiste Onofré <jbono...@apache.org>
>>>         * Frances Perry <fran...@apache.org>
>>>         * Amit Sela <amits...@apache.org>
>>>         * Josh Wills <jwi...@apache.org>
>>> 
>>>       N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ED, that Davor Bonaci
>>>       be appointed to the office of Vice President, Apache Beam, to
>>>       serve in accordance with and subject to the direction of the
>>>       Board of Directors and the Bylaws of the Foundation until
>>>       death, resignation, retirement, removal or disqualification,
>>>       or until a successor is appointed; and be it further
>>> 
>>>       RESOLVED, that the initial Apache Beam PMC be and hereby is
>>>       tasked with the creation of a set of bylaws intended to
>>>       encourage open development and increased participation in the
>>>       Apache Beam Project; and be it further
>>> 
>>>       RESOLVED, that the Apache Beam Project be and hereby
>>>       is tasked with the migration and rationalization of the Apache
>>>       Incubator Beam podling; and be it further
>>> 
>>>       RESOLVED, that all responsibilities pertaining to the Apache
>>>       Incubator Beam podling encumbered upon the Apache Incubator
>>>       Project are hereafter discharged.
